Big Sky Tournament Thread (2021) - Men

Posted: Sat Mar 06, 2021 9:03 pm
by Mvemjsunpx
    • First Round
    (9) Sacramento St. (5-9, 8-11) vs. (8) Northern Colorado (6-8, 10-10) - Wednesday, March 10, 9:00 AM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    (10) Northern Arizona (4-10, 5-15) vs. (7) Portland St. (6-8, 9-12) - Wednesday, March 10, 12: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    (11) Idaho (1-17, 1-20) vs. (6) Montana (7-9, 13-12) - Wednesday, March 10, 3: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    • Quarterfinals
    (8/9 Winner) vs. (1) Southern Utah (12-2, 19-3) - Thursday, March 11, 11:00 AM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    (5) Montana St. (8-6, 11-9) vs. (4) Idaho St. (8-6, 13-10) - Thursday, March 11, 2: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    (7/10 Winner) vs. (2) Eastern Washington (12-3, 13-7) - Thursday, March 11, 5: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    (6/11 Winner) vs. (3) Weber St. (12-3, 17-5) - Thursday, March 11, 8: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    • Semifinals
    (early QF winners) - Friday, March 12, 5: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    (late QF winners) - Friday, March 12, 8:00 PM MST on Watch Big Sky/Pluto TV

    • Championship
    (semifinal winners) - Saturday, March 13, 6:00 PM MST on ESPNU

      • (entire tournament at Idaho Central Arena in Boise, ID)

by Wildcat Ryan
SDHornet wrote: Wed Mar 10, 2021 12:04 pm
Wildcat Ryan wrote: Wed Mar 10, 2021 9:50 am Very fast and high scoring first half. Wonder if either team will decide to tighten up their defense in the 2nd.

Been a good game to start but.........these tournament games really need to go back to host sites.
No thanks.

Used to be a lot more excitement in the tournament and getting #1 actually meant something. The Big Sky is a one bid league and giving the #1 team the best shot is the way to go. I know its more convenient to do it at a predetermined site but The Big Sky killed a lot of the regular season fight for 1st excitement.

Also only so many teams should make the tournament. Maybe top 8. Nothing against Idaho but in no way does that team deserve any post season play.
